New Cardi B music is coming sooner than you might have thought. Her new freestyle "Like What" will drop Friday. A snippet of the song was released via a verified fan account Wednesday (Feb. 28).

"YA FOUND ME," Cardi wrote across her socials alongside cover art for the track. "Like What freestyle FRIDAY."

In the cover art, the rapper has dyed-pink eyebrows, with matching eyeshadow, lashes, and contacts. Her hand is covering one side of her face showing off her extra long white nails.

The snippet she released on Tuesday (Feb. 27) seemingly samples Missy Elliott‘s 1999 classic "She’s A Bitch." The clip contains a short snippet of the new offering with hashtags #CardiCountdown and #WhereIsCardi.

Cardi B Starts Rollout For New Song With Fake "Missing" Posters

In the clip posted by the verified fan account, the caption read, "After the anonymous tip we believe we may have located Cardi B. Check in tomorrow for a special update," signaling a possible release date for the song.

The as-yet-untitled song will follow Cardi's 2023 "Bongos," which featured Megan Thee Stallion. It was the only single that the Bronx native dropped that year.

Cardi B Explains Why She Hasn't Dropped Her New Album

Cardi has been open about not dropping music with her fans despite the pleas for her sophomore album.

"When it comes to music and everything, I just be feeling like I don’t be liking anything," she said back in December 2022 on Instagram Live. "I feel like I got so many songs and I don’t like anything. I feel like nothing is good enough… And I got so much money saved up I just be like, 'Yeah, whatever the f---.'"

She added that the pressure from everyone commenting on what she does also plays a role, although she has decided to block it out and keep going.

"I used to love making music, but now, making music to me has become like a job that gives me anxiety," Cardi B says in the video. "Everybody just critiques everything that I do, that it’s just like…you know, sometimes you just don’t want to do something that may give you that much anxiety. So I just be like, "Uh!" — freezing myself but I have to let that go. I have to release more music — I have to go out there."

"Like What" is out Friday.

TikTok is a place where you can find out your favorite artist's personality. Artists and their teams have been able to leverage social media to their advantage. It gives fans an inside look at who they are as a person outside of their music.

Latto is a perfect example of how she uses social media to her advantage and connects with fans. She often posts silly videos of her and her sister Brooklyn trying new food, participating in TikTok challenges, and previewing new music.

The Atlanta native has had an exciting year thus far as she was nominated for two Grammys. Latto was nominated for Best New Artist and her "Big Energy (Live)" was nominated for Best Melodic Rap Performance at the 2023 Grammy Awards. On top of that, she just won her second BET Award on Sunday for Best Female Hip Hop Artist.

She later hit the stage to perform her latest single "Put It On Da Floor."

Latto and Cardi B "Put It On Da Floor Again," for the remix of her viral hit. The firey remix accompanies their music video, where Latto and Cardi B run around a grocery store, jewelry store and party reciting the lyrics. Cardi B's husband Offset makes a cameo as does LSU star Angel Reese.

Besides music, Latto has used social media to clear up any beef she's had with fellow rappers. Back in March, a fan accused Latto of mimicking Ice Spice's cover to her debut EP Like...?

"Every time y’all accuse me of copying folks ima clear it up. Nun mo nun less."

"I don’t like how y’all take my tweets & make them fit ur weak a-- narratives," she added in a separate tweet.
